SEO Keywords KIMGID × Article Keyword Pool
DB: /var/www/www-root/data/www/saltolibero.ru/seo_keywords/kimgid/article_keyword_pool.sqlite
Сбросить

Как остановить процесс Linux

URL
https://vseprolinux.ru/blog/terminal/kill-linux/
Проект
seo_keywords_kimgid
Тип
Статьи (article)
Домен
vseprolinux.ru
Path
/blog/terminal/kill-linux/
H1
Как остановить процесс Linux
Meta title
Как эффективно завершать процессы в Linux: руководство по командам и сигналам
Meta description
Узнайте, как завершать процессы в Linux с помощью команд pkill, killall и сигналов SIGTERM, SIGKILL. Подробное руководство по управлению процессами.
Кластер
Управление процессами в Linux
Main topic
Завершение процессов в Linux
Intent
informational · Как завершить процессы в Linux
Commercial angle
Предложение инструментов для мониторинга и управления процессами в Linux.
Text len
5815 / sent 5815
Cache
нет cache-путей в текущей БД

Запросы: 37

ТипЗапросПриоритетIntent
commercialлучшие утилиты для управления процессами в linux1commercial
commercialинструменты для мониторинга процессов в linux1commercial
commercialпрограммы для управления процессами в linux1commercial
commercialсравнение утилит pkill и killall1commercial
commercialобзор команд для завершения процессов в linux1commercial
long_tailкак завершить зависший процесс в linux1informational
long_tailчто делать если процесс не завершается в linux1informational
long_tailкак использовать сигналы для завершения процессов в linux1informational
long_tailкак правильно завершить процесс в linux1informational
long_tailкак использовать команду kill в linux1informational
long_tailразличия между sigterm и sigkill в linux1informational
long_tailкак завершить все процессы с одинаковым именем в linux1informational
long_tailкак завершить процесс по имени программы в linux1informational
long_tailкак завершить процесс через терминал в linux1informational
long_tailкак завершить процесс с помощью pkill в linux1informational
long_tailкак завершить процесс с помощью killall в linux1informational
long_tailкак завершить процесс с помощью sigint в linux1informational
long_tailкак завершить процесс с помощью sigquit в linux1informational
long_tailкак завершить процесс с помощью sighup в linux1informational
long_tailкак завершить процесс с помощью sigterm в linux1informational
long_tailкак завершить процесс с помощью sigkill в linux1informational
primaryкак остановить процесс в linux1informational
primaryкоманда kill в linux1informational
primaryзавершение процессов в linux1informational
primaryсигналы для завершения процессов linux1informational
secondarypkill linux1informational
secondarykillall linux1informational
secondarysigterm linux1informational
secondarysigkill linux1informational
secondarysighup linux1informational
secondarysigint linux1informational
secondarysigquit linux1informational
secondaryкак использовать pkill1informational
secondaryкак использовать killall1informational
secondaryзавершение ssh сессии linux1informational
secondaryкак найти pid процесса1informational
secondaryуправление процессами через терминал linux1informational

FAQ: 7

#ВопросОтвет
1Какой сигнал использовать для завершения процесса в Linux?В Linux для завершения процесса можно использовать различные сигналы. Наиболее распространённые из них: SIGTERM, который корректно завершает процесс, и SIGKILL, который немедленно завершает процесс без возможности его обработки. SIGINT и SIGQUIT также могут быть использованы для завершения процессов, запущенных из терминала. Выбор сигнала зависит от ситуации и необходимости корректного завершения процесса.
1Как завершить процесс по имени программы в Linux?Для завершения процесса по имени программы в Linux можно использовать утилиту pkill. Она позволяет отправить сигнал завершения процессу, указав его имя. Например, чтобы завершить процесс программы mc, достаточно ввести команду pkill mc. Утилита самостоятельно найдет процесс с указанным именем и отправит ему сигнал SIGTERM для завершения.
1Чем отличается SIGTERM от SIGKILL в Linux?SIGTERM и SIGKILL — это сигналы для завершения процессов в Linux. SIGTERM отправляет процессу запрос на корректное завершение, позволяя ему освободить ресурсы и завершить дочерние процессы. SIGKILL, в отличие от SIGTERM, немедленно завершает процесс без возможности его обработки, что может привести к потере данных или некорректному освобождению ресурсов.
1Как найти PID процесса в Linux?Для нахождения PID (идентификатора процесса) в Linux можно использовать команду ps. Например, команда ps aux | grep имя_процесса отобразит список процессов, где можно найти нужный PID. В выводе команды PID будет указан во втором столбце. Это значение можно использовать для дальнейших операций с процессом, таких как его завершение.
1Как завершить SSH-сессию в Linux?Для завершения SSH-сессии в Linux можно использовать команду kill с указанием PID процесса SSH. Сначала необходимо найти PID с помощью команды ps aux | grep ssh. После этого, используя команду kill PID, можно завершить процесс SSH-сессии. Если процесс не завершается, можно попробовать использовать сигнал SIGKILL для принудительного завершения.
1Что делать, если процесс не завершается в Linux?Если процесс не завершается в Linux после отправки сигнала SIGTERM, можно попробовать использовать сигнал SIGKILL, который принудительно завершает процесс. Для этого используется команда kill -KILL PID. Однако стоит помнить, что SIGKILL не позволяет процессу корректно завершиться, что может привести к потере данных или некорректному освобождению ресурсов.
1Как завершить все процессы с одинаковым именем в Linux?Для завершения всех процессов с одинаковым именем в Linux можно использовать команду killall. Эта утилита завершает все процессы, имеющие указанное имя. Например, команда killall mc завершит все процессы программы mc. Это удобно, когда необходимо завершить несколько экземпляров одной программы одновременно.

LSI и Entities: 40

LSI: 25

killallpid процессаpkillsighupsigintsigkillsigquitsigtermssh сессиявременные файлыдочерние процессызавершение программызависший процессидентификатор процессаинициализация системыкоманда psкорректное завершениеосвобождение ресурсовпроцессы в linuxсигналы завершениясокетытерминал linuxуправление процессамиутилита killфоновый режим

Entities: 15

Arch LinuxBashCentOSDebianFedoraGNUKali LinuxLinuxOpenSUSERed HatSSHShellSystemdUbuntuUnix

Content gaps: 8

#Что добавить/усилить
1Как избежать потери данных при завершении процессов
1Рекомендации по безопасному завершению процессов
1Как восстановить процесс после некорректного завершения
1Инструменты для мониторинга процессов в реальном времени
1Как настроить автоматическое завершение процессов
1Сравнение эффективности различных сигналов
1Как завершить процессы в других дистрибутивах Linux
1Ошибки при использовании команд pkill и killall

Анкоры: 8

ТипАнкорПриоритет
naturalуправление процессами в Linux1
naturalсигналы завершения процессов1
naturalиспользование команды pkill1
naturalиспользование команды killall1
naturalкак найти PID процесса1
naturalзавершение SSH-сессии1
naturalразличия между SIGTERM и SIGKILL1
naturalзавершение зависших процессов1